  • Responsive Communication

  • Combining attention to sensory issues with using body language (intensiv
  • Responsive Communication' is a holistic way of getting in touch with autistic children and adults with whom we struggle to communicate. It is an extension of Intensive Interaction that pays attention to and responds to individual body language, but at the same time, addresses sensory processing issues and emotional distress.

  • The Secret Life of Stories

  • From Don Quixote to Harry Potter, How Understanding Intellectual Disabil
  • How an understanding of intellectual disability transforms the pleasures of reading Narrative informs everything we think, do, plan, remember, and imagine. We tell stories and we listen to stories, gauging their "well-formedness" within a couple of years of learning to walk and talk. Some argue that the capacity to understand narrative is innate ......
